Methods for Defrosting Pork Chops

There are three main methods for defrosting pork chops:

1. Refrigerator Thawing

This is the safest and most recommended method for defrosting pork chops. Simply place the frozen pork chops in the refrigerator and allow them to thaw slowly over the course of 24-48 hours. This method preserves the quality of the meat and prevents the growth of bacteria.

2. Cold Water Thawing

This method is faster than refrigerator thawing, but it requires more attention. Place the frozen pork chops in a sealed plastic bag and submerge them in cold water. Change the water every 30 minutes to ensure that the pork chops are thawing evenly. This method can take anywhere from 2-4 hours, depending on the thickness of the pork chops.

3. Microwave Thawing

This is the quickest method for defrosting pork chops, but it requires careful monitoring to prevent overcooking. Place the frozen pork chops on a microwave-safe plate and defrost them on the defrost setting for 2-3 minutes per pound. Be sure to check the pork chops frequently to ensure that they are not overcooking.

Tips for Defrosting Pork Chops

  • Don’t thaw pork chops at room temperature. This can promote the growth of bacteria.
  • Don’t overcook pork chops after defrosting. Overcooked pork chops will be tough and dry.
  • Cook pork chops to an internal temperature of 145°F. This will ensure that the pork chops are cooked safely and thoroughly.
  • Use defrosted pork chops within 24 hours. Defrosted pork chops can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ours before cooking.

Thawing Times for Pork Chops

The amount of time it takes to defrost pork chops will vary depending on the method used and the thickness of the pork chops. Here are some general guidelines:

  • Refrigerator Thawing: 24-48 hours
  • Cold Water Thawing: 2-4 hours
  • Microwave Thawing: 2-3 minutes per pound

Answers to Your Questions

Q: How long can I store defrosted pork chops in the refrigerator?
A: Defrosted pork chops can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ours.

Q: Can I defrost pork chops in the microwave without a defrost setting?
A: Yes, but you will need to defrost the pork chops on a lower power setting and check them frequently to prevent overcooking.

Q: What is the best way to cook defrosted pork chops?
A: Defrosted pork chops can be cooked in a variety of ways, including grilling, pan-frying, baking, or roasting.

Q: Can I marinate defrosted pork chops?
A: Yes, you can marinate defrosted pork chops to add flavor. However, be sure to discard the marinade after marinating the pork chops.

Q: How do I know if pork chops are cooked through?
A: Insert a meat thermometer into the thickest part of the pork chop. If the internal temperature is 145°F or higher, the pork chops are cooked through.
